Output 598f44b70022d0ddfb19cc212efe6f6d230cd43d737ae75ae46d53258dcab759:0

value
383825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a41610c7f6017225980668de301722c28693ad8 OP_EQUAL
address
3EJ3VdpZePycY5jJnNC3tKyyhKx2Sxf95C
transaction
598f44b70022d0ddfb19cc212efe6f6d230cd43d737ae75ae46d53258dcab759
confirmations
326674
spent
true